1. The Martian

  • USA, 2015.
  • Science fiction, adventure.
  • Duration: 142 minutes.
  • IMDb: 8, 0.

In the world of the future, a group of scientists hastily leaves Mars due to a storm that has begun. During the evacuation, one of Watney's expedition members is injured. Colleagues are sure that he died, and therefore fly away without him. But Watney comes to his senses and realizes that now he must somehow survive alone on a distant planet.

Ridley Scott's film is based on the book of the same name by Andy Weier. However, this did not prevent the authors of the now emerging Russian film "The Alien" from declaring that the studio had stolen the idea of the script from them, and even suing the creators of "The Martian". Of course, the claim was not satisfied.

2. Remember everything

  • USA, 1990.
  • Science fiction, action, adventure.
  • Duration: 113 minutes.
  • IMDb: 7, 5.

The life of the builder Doug Quaid is pretty boring. He decides to go to the Recall company, which invites visitors to implant fake memories. After such a visit, a person is completely sure that he has visited other planets and carried out dangerous missions there. But it turns out that Doug is indeed a secret agent who visited Mars, and his real memories have been erased. Remembering everything, the hero goes to the Red Planet to sort out his past.

This film was born out of a very small story by the famous science fiction writer Philip K. Dick. The plot corresponds to the plot of the work, but then the action develops in a completely different way. At the same time, the hero of the book is an ordinary office clerk, and Arnold Schwarzenegger was absolutely not suitable for such a role. Especially for him, the character's profession was changed to a builder.

3. Capricorn-1

  • USA, UK, 1977.
  • Drama, thriller.
  • Duration: 123 minutes.
  • IMDb: 6, 8.

In the mid-80s, a manned expedition to Mars is being prepared in the United States. However, before the flight, the management understands that the life support systems are not working and the crew will most likely die. To avoid a scandal, the ship is sent into flight without a crew, and the members of the expedition are forced to take part in a staged landing on Mars. Everything goes smoothly until one of the NASA employees and his fellow journalist notices that some of the signals are coming from Earth.

This fictional story refers to a very popular conspiracy theory: many still believe that the Americans did not actually land on the moon, but filmed the installation of the flag in the studio.

4. John Carter

  • USA, 2012.
  • Science fiction, action, adventure.
  • Duration: 132 minutes.
  • IMDb: 6, 6.

Civil War veteran John Carter suddenly lands on Mars. Due to the lower gravity, he is almost a superhero there. Now he has to become a participant in the war for the independence of the peoples of the Red Planet.

The film is based on Edgar Burroughs' classic novel The Princess of Mars, light pulp fiction with a touch of fantasy. Despite the book's cult status, the expensive film adaptation failed at the box office, causing huge losses to the studio. But in Russia they fell in love with this film - it set a record for the box office.

5. Mars attacks

  • USA, 1996.
  • Science fiction, black comedy.
  • Duration: 106 minutes.
  • IMDb: 6, 3.

The long-awaited contact with an alien civilization took place: once the Martians landed on Earth. They announced that they had come in peace, after which they began to shoot everyone who got in their way and blow up cities. As it turns out later, they can only be destroyed in a very unusual way.

This film by Tim Burton stands out from the director's usual gothic style, but the traditional black humor and grotesque characters fully compensate for the strange picture.

6. Red planet

  • USA, Australia, 2000.
  • Science fiction, action, thriller.
  • Duration: 106 minutes.
  • IMDb: 5, 7.

The earth is suffering from pollution and overpopulation, and people are trying to colonize Mars. Special probes spread algae on the planet, which should produce oxygen, but after a while the process stops. A small team goes to Mars to deal with the situation, but on approach, the ship breaks down, and the astronauts are practically abandoned on a distant planet. They are threatened by a lack of oxygen and unknown insects. In addition, the robot that was supposed to accompany them on the expedition goes into combat mode.

7. Mission to Mars

  • USA, 2000.
  • Science fiction, thriller, drama.
  • Duration: 114 minutes.
  • IMDb: 5, 6.

In 2020, a mission to Mars encounters a mysterious phenomenon - a semi-intelligent vortex. Almost all members of the expedition die, and then another team is sent to the Red Planet. Having figured out what happened, its participants find themselves on the verge of a discovery that will shed light on the very appearance of a person.

8. The last days on Mars

  • UK, Ireland, 2013.
  • Science fiction, thriller, horror.
  • Duration: 98 minutes.
  • IMDb: 5, 5.

On the last day of the Martian expedition, a member of a small crew discovers microscopic traces of a local life form in soil samples. He tries to hide his find, but soon almost all the astronauts are infected with a virus that turns them into monsters.

This film received low reviews from critics. Many felt that it was too simple for science fiction and not brutal enough for a real thriller, but the atmosphere of suspicion and general tension in this picture is perfectly conveyed.

9. The Mystery of the Red Planet

  • USA, 2011.
  • Science fiction, adventure.
  • Duration: 88 minutes.
  • IMDb: 5, 4.

Milo once had a violent fight with his mother over the fact that she forced him to eat broccoli. He wished her to disappear, and that same night she was stolen by aliens. It turns out that there was no one on the Red Planet to raise children, so the Martians kidnapped other people's mothers. Milo, with the support of the bully Gribble, has to save his mother.

For some reason, in the Russian localization, they decided to add seriousness to this animated film, because in the original it is simply called “Mars needs mothers”.

10. Doom

  • USA, UK, Germany, Czech Republic, 2005.
  • Science fiction, action, horror.
  • Duration: 100 minutes.
  • IMDb: 5, 2.

In 2046, a signal for help comes from the Martian laboratory. A detachment of marines from Earth is sent to Mars through a special spatial gate. Arriving at the place, people discover that genetic experiments were carried out there and now the laboratory is filled with insane mutants.

The plot of this film is based on the game Doom 3, but in the film adaptation the very plot of the story has been greatly changed. But there is a scene where the action is filmed in the first person - it reminds of the atmosphere of the original.

12. Ghosts of Mars

  • USA, 2001.
  • Science fiction, action, horror.
  • Duration: 98 minutes.
  • IMDb: 4, 9.

In the XXII century, Mars was already colonized, an earthly atmosphere was created there. Suddenly, the settlers discover a door leading to an ancient cave. It is inhabited by ghosts that can enter the bodies of people, turning them into zombies. The police woman and the criminal she is transporting have to fight them.

The author of "" John Carpenter is called the master of second-rate cinema. He loves making cheap sci-fi and horror movies with consistently grotesque characters and predictable dialogue. For this, many critics scold him, but an army of fans rejoices in every director's work.

13. Mars

  • USA, 2016.
  • Science fiction, drama.
  • Duration: 1 season.
  • IMDb: 7, 5.

In 2033, the Daedalus spacecraft delivers six people to Mars. They must create the first human settlement on the planet, but they have to face many dangers of an unknown world.

This series is produced by the National Geographic Channel, so Mars features an interesting combination of fantasy, drama and a purely scientific approach. The action is regularly interrupted by interviews with various scientists suggesting possible solutions for the colonization of the Red Planet.

14. First

  • USA, 2018.
  • Science fiction, drama.
  • Duration: 1 season.
  • IMDb: 6, 7.

In the not too distant future, a group of engineers, scientists and astronauts are sent on the first manned flight to Mars. They must colonize the Red Planet. The plot tells not only about the dangers faced by the pioneers, but also about difficult times for their relatives and colleagues left on Earth.
